研究概览

简要总结

Sepsis is a heterogeneous and complex syndrome, characterized by a dysregulated host response to infection which can be life-threatening.

•       The major causes of admission to Intensive Care Units (ICUs)

•        Mortality rate ranges from 25-50%.

•       The association of lactate level with mortality in patients with suspected infection and sepsis is well established.

•       ΔpCO2 reflects the difference in partial pressure of carbon dioxide (pCO2) between central venous blood and arterial blood.

•       It has been proposed as an indicator of tissue perfusion and may offer insights into sepsis severity.

•       While it is not a direct measure of oxygen delivery, ΔpCO2 can provide valuable information about the adequacy of tissue perfusion and the presence of global tissue hypoxia.

•       This study aimed to determine the change in central venous and arterial pCO2 difference (ΔpCO2 ) at 0 and 6 hours to predict outcome in sepsis patients. This can act as an alternative marker to lactate clearance.
